There is a long line of research investigating upper central series of a group. The interest comes from the information which these series can give on the structure of a group. Baer (1952) extended the usual notion of center of a group, introducing that of p-centre, where p is a prime. Almost 40 years later, Kappe and Newell (1989) were able to embed the p-centre of a metabelian p-group in the p-th term of the upper central series. This was possible because of the growing knowledge on Engel groups of the 60s years. Here we extend the result of Kappe and Newell (1989) to wider classes of groups.
